Subject: [PATCH 11/17] OMAP4: powerdomain data: add voltage domains
Date: Wed, 30 Mar 2011 17:16:14 -0700	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1301530580-12046-12-git-send-email-khilman@ti.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1301530580-12046-1-git-send-email-khilman@ti.com>

From: Benoit Cousson <b-cousson@ti.com>

Add voltage domain name to indicate which voltagedomain each
powerdomain is in.

The fixed voltage domain like ldo_wakeup for emu and wkup power
domain is added too.

Update the TI copyright date to 2011.

Signed-off-by: Benoit Cousson <b-cousson@ti.com>
Cc: Paul Walmsley <paul@pwsan.com>
[khilman@ti.com]: renamed wakeup domain: s/ldo_wakeup/wakeup/
Signed-off-by: Kevin Hilman <khilman@ti.com>

diff --git a/arch/arm/mach-omap2/powerdomains44xx_data.c b/arch/arm/mach-omap2/powerdomains44xx_data.c
index c4222c7..af91554 100644
--- a/arch/arm/mach-omap2/powerdomains44xx_data.c
+++ b/arch/arm/mach-omap2/powerdomains44xx_data.c
@@ -1,7 +1,7 @@
 /*
  * OMAP4 Power domains framework
  *
- * Copyright (C) 2009-2010 Texas Instruments, Inc.
+ * Copyright (C) 2009-2011 Texas Instruments, Inc.
  * Copyright (C) 2009-2011 Nokia Corporation
  *
  * Abhijit Pagare (abhijitpagare@ti.com)
@@ -33,6 +33,7 @@
 /* core_44xx_pwrdm: CORE power domain */
 static struct powerdomain core_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"core_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"core"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RM_CORE_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RM_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
@@ -59,6 +60,7 @@ static struct powerdomain core_44xx_pwrdm = {
 /* gfx_44xx_pwrdm: 3D accelerator power domain */
 static struct powerdomain gfx_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"gfx_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"core"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RM_GFX_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RM_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
@@ -76,6 +78,7 @@ static struct powerdomain gfx_44xx_pwrdm = {
 /* abe_44xx_pwrdm: Audio back end power domain */
 static struct powerdomain abe_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"abe_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"iva"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RM_ABE_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RM_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
@@ -96,6 +99,7 @@ static struct powerdomain abe_44xx_pwrdm = {
 /* dss_44xx_pwrdm: Display subsystem power domain */
 static struct powerdomain dss_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"dss_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"core"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RM_DSS_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RM_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
@@ -114,6 +118,7 @@ static struct powerdomain dss_44xx_pwrdm = {
 /* tesla_44xx_pwrdm: Tesla processor power domain */
 static struct powerdomain tesla_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"tesla_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"iva"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RM_TESLA_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RM_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
@@ -136,6 +141,7 @@ static struct powerdomain tesla_44xx_pwrdm = {
 /* wkup_44xx_pwrdm: Wake-up power domain */
 static struct powerdomain wkup_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"wkup_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"wakeup"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RM_WKUP_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RM_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
@@ -152,6 +158,7 @@ static struct powerdomain wkup_44xx_pwrdm = {
 /* cpu0_44xx_pwrdm: MPU0 processor and Neon coprocessor power domain */
 static struct powerdomain cpu0_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"cpu0_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"mpu"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RCM_MPU_CPU0_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RCM_MPU_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
@@ -169,6 +176,7 @@ static struct powerdomain cpu0_44xx_pwrdm = {
 /* cpu1_44xx_pwrdm: MPU1 processor and Neon coprocessor power domain */
 static struct powerdomain cpu1_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"cpu1_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"mpu"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RCM_MPU_CPU1_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RCM_MPU_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
@@ -186,6 +194,7 @@ static struct powerdomain cpu1_44xx_pwrdm = {
 /* emu_44xx_pwrdm: Emulation power domain */
 static struct powerdomain emu_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"emu_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"wakeup"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RM_EMU_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RM_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
@@ -202,6 +211,7 @@ static struct powerdomain emu_44xx_pwrdm = {
 /* mpu_44xx_pwrdm: Modena processor and the Neon coprocessor power domain */
 static struct powerdomain mpu_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"mpu_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"mpu"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RM_MPU_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RM_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
@@ -223,6 +233,7 @@ static struct powerdomain mpu_44xx_pwrdm = {
 /* ivahd_44xx_pwrdm: IVA-HD power domain */
 static struct powerdomain ivahd_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"ivahd_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"iva"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RM_IVAHD_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RM_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
@@ -247,6 +258,7 @@ static struct powerdomain ivahd_44xx_pwrdm = {
 /* cam_44xx_pwrdm: Camera subsystem power domain */
 static struct powerdomain cam_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"cam_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"core"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RM_CAM_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RM_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
@@ -264,6 +276,7 @@ static struct powerdomain cam_44xx_pwrdm = {
 /* l3init_44xx_pwrdm: L3 initators pheripherals power domain  */
 static struct powerdomain l3init_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"l3init_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"core"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RM_L3INIT_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RM_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
@@ -282,6 +295,7 @@ static struct powerdomain l3init_44xx_pwrdm = {
 /* l4per_44xx_pwrdm: Target peripherals power domain */
 static struct powerdomain l4per_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"l4per_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"core"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RM_L4PER_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RM_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
@@ -305,6 +319,7 @@ static struct powerdomain l4per_44xx_pwrdm = {
  */
 static struct powerdomain always_on_core_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"always_on_core_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"core"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RM_ALWAYS_ON_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RM_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
@@ -314,6 +329,7 @@ static struct powerdomain always_on_core_44xx_pwrdm = {
 /* cefuse_44xx_pwrdm: Customer efuse controller power domain */
 static struct powerdomain cefuse_44xx_pwrdm = {
 	.name		  = "cefuse_pwrdm",
+	.voltdm		  = { .name = "core" },
 	.prcm_offs	  = OMAP4430_PRM_CEFUSE_INST,
 	.prcm_partition	  = OMAP4430_PRM_PARTITION,
 	.omap_chip	  = OMAP_CHIP_INIT(CHIP_IS_OMAP4430),
diff --git a/arch/arm/mach-omap2/voltagedomains44xx_data.c b/arch/arm/mach-omap2/voltagedomains44xx_data.c
index 95e1ce5..9a17b5e 100644
--- a/arch/arm/mach-omap2/voltagedomains44xx_data.c
+++ b/arch/arm/mach-omap2/voltagedomains44xx_data.c
@@ -86,10 +86,15 @@ static struct voltagedomain omap4_voltdm_core = {
 	.vdd = &omap4_vdd_core_info,
 };
 
+static struct voltagedomain omap4_voltdm_wkup = {
+	.name = "wakeup",
+};
+
 static struct voltagedomain *voltagedomains_omap4[] __initdata = {
 	&omap4_voltdm_mpu,
 	&omap4_voltdm_iva,
 	&omap4_voltdm_core,
+	&omap4_voltdm_wkup,
 	NULL,
 };
